Displacement, Food Insecurity, and Conflict: The Crisis in Sudan

Thu, 14 November, 2024 7:00pm - 8:30pm

SHAI will be hosting Displacement, Food Insecurity, and Conflict: The Crisis in Sudan, on Thursday November 14 from 7-8:30pm in Elliott Room 505. Panelists include GW professors Marie Price and Steven Hansch, USAID Counselor and previous Mission Director Tom Staal, and USIP Sudan Program Advisor Manal Taha. The panel will provide insight into the largest displacement crisis in the world relating to Sudan's food insecurity, security concerns, and humanitarian aid. Food will be catered.
